The work:
As a .NET/React Full Stack Developer, you will play a critical role in the development and maintenance of web applications and services. You will be responsible for designing, coding, testing, and deploying high-quality software solutions using the .NET framework and associated technologies, as well as React. Your expertise in both front-end and back-end development will be essential in creating seamless and efficient user experiences. You will collaborate closely with cross-functional teams, including designers, product managers, and other developers, to deliver robust and scalable applications. In this role, you will engage in the full software development lifecycle, from concept and design to testing and deployment. You will be expected to write clean, maintainable, and efficient code, and to adhere to best practices and coding standards. Your ability to troubleshoot and resolve complex technical issues will be crucial in ensuring the reliability and performance of our applications. Additionally, you will participate in code reviews, provide constructive feedback, and contribute to the continuous improvement of our development processes.
What you’ll need:
- Bachelor's Degree and at least 5 years of experience.
- Experienced with.NET languages (e.g. C#, ADO.NET, EF).
- Familiarity or experience with architecture styles/APIs (REST, RPC).
- Develop and maintain web applications using React, TypeScript, JavaScript, Node.js and HTML5/CSS3.
- Familiarity with cloud platforms like AWS or Azure.
- Active Top Secret clearance.
- Willingness to work onsite in Washington, DC.
